Oranmiyan chides Obasanjo over attack on Buhari


The Oranmiyan group, has chided former president Olusegun Obasanjo for liking the administration of President Muhammadu Buhari with General Sanni Abacha in his new letter.


The group stated that Obasanjo should not be taken with his utterances because of his failure to stand by his earlier statement made on Atiku Abubakar.


Speaking at the Correspondents’ Chapel of the Nigeria Union of Journalists, NUJ, Osogbo, Osun State capital, during a courtesy visit of the new executives of the group, the Director General, Mr. Olajide Sadiq, said President Buhari has not done anything undemocratic since his assumption.


He said ex-president Obasanjo has only expressed his freedom of speech as guaranteed in the Constitution of Nigeria, and he is entitled to his opinion as a Nigerian.


He recalled that the same Obasanjo that said that God should punish him if he support Atiku, is now supporting him, forgetting that he has cursed himself.


The group also assured that Governor Gboyega Oyetola will perform well “even better than the former Governor, Rauf Aregbesola.


He noted that Aregbesola’s administration has improved security of the state that residence can now sleep with two eyes closed and their doors open.


The group however called for support of the media to the administration of Oyetola by reporting him accurately.
